Quale logica viene utilizzata per controllare le azioni di blocco e aggiornamento nelle reti P2P? (simile al Bitcoin)

7

Bitcoin si basa sulla Prova di Lavoro (hashing) per controllare la scrittura su un repository centrale (la blockchain). Si basa anche su un insieme di regole per questi aggiornamenti e definisce cosa succede se viene trovato un conflitto (vincite a catena più lunghe)

Usandolo come esempio per la mia domanda:

  • Quali sono alcuni esempi architettonici di diversi meccanismi di blocco e / o aggiornamento distribuiti adatti alle reti P2P? (Sto cercando descrizioni del software design adatto a questo progetto, non a prodotti software)

  • Quale logica o regole chiave sono fondamentali per quel "database" decentralizzato?

posta random65537 18.07.2013 - 00:23
fonte

1 risposta

1

Bitcoin, Bittorrent, TOR e molta infrastruttura di Amazon (i bit decentralizzati) funzionano tutti usando qualcosa chiamato Distributed Hash Tables.

Onestamente, non lo capisco abbastanza bene da spiegarlo abbastanza bene. Steve Gibson ne ha fatto un buon riassunto qualche tempo fa se hai 30 minuti per ascoltarlo.

Link.

    
risposta data 26.07.2013 - 19:17
fonte

Leggi altre domande sui tag